How do I use the Transactions Report?

This article explains how to use the Transactions Report in Fease to view all financial transactions, track debit order payments, and identify bounced collections.

Fease > Reports > Transactions Report

What does the Transactions Report show?

  • Payments received: All money received against debtor accounts.

  • Debit order status: Successful debit order collections and their amounts.

  • Debit order bounces: Failed payment collections that need follow-up.

  • Journal entries: Write-offs, handovers to collections, and other adjustments.

How do I use this report?

Filter by date range, transaction type, or account to analyse financial activity. This report is particularly useful for tracking debit order bounce rates and reconciling payments received against outstanding balances.

Frequently asked questions

Does this report include cashless payments?

The Transactions Report covers all financial transactions including EFT and debit orders. For cashless-specific payments (Pay Now button), use the Payments Report.

How do I identify debit order bounces?

Filter by transaction type to see failed debit order collections. These accounts may need manual follow-up or a change in payment method.

Where does the transaction data come from?

All transaction data is synced from d6+ Plus Finance. Ensure data is up to date by checking the last sync time via Sync Now.
